Top Senator's Brother-in-Law Involved in Recruiting Chinese Companies to Democratic Stronghold

Top Senator’s Brother-in-Law Involved in Recruiting Chinese Companies to Democratic Stronghold

News EditorBy News EditorMarch 27, 2025 Politics 6 Mins Read

In a comprehensive review, it has been revealed that Anthony “Tony” Malkin, the brother-in-law of Democratic Senator Richard Blumenthal, has maintained close ties with diplomats associated with the Chinese Communist Party (CCP). Malkin, who is also the CEO of Empire State Realty Trust, has reportedly hosted multiple Chinese consuls general and actively recruited Chinese companies to lease office space in New York City. This scrutiny highlights a potential conflict of interest given Malkin’s family connection to a prominent U.S. politician and raises significant questions about foreign influence in American business.

Background on Malkin and His Business Ventures

Anthony “Tony” Malkin is the current chairman and CEO of Empire State Realty Trust, Inc., a significant player in New York’s real estate market. This company, which operates the iconic Empire State Building, has a broad portfolio comprising nearly 600 tenants and 732 residential units. Malkin’s role as CEO places him at the center of one of the most recognized landmarks in New York City, making him a key figure in both real estate and political circles.

Educated at Harvard University, Malkin inherited a portion of his real estate empire and has developed it through various strategies aimed at attracting diverse tenants. His business acumen has allowed him to secure leases with international corporations, significantly expanding his interests in the commercial property sector. His ventures have included a focus on foreign interests, particularly those from China, which has raised eyebrows.

Connections with Chinese Diplomats and Companies

Over the past 15 years, Malkin has reportedly played host to multiple consuls general from the People’s Republic of China. This consistent engagement raises questions about the nature of these relationships and the potential influence of the CCP on American soil. In several instances, Malkin traveled to China to attract firms looking to establish a presence in the United States, facilitating their leasing arrangements in New York. His actions have been highlighted in various media outlets, bringing attention to his recruiting efforts for Chinese businesses seeking office space.

In a profile from 2011, Chinese state media highlighted Malkin’s role in connecting Chinese companies with U.S. markets, specifically focusing on lucrative leasing opportunities. Notable tenants have included state-run entities like Air China and others associated with the CCP, including a subsidiary of the People’s Daily, which is known for its propaganda ties to the government. Malkin’s actions reflect a broader trend of increasing Chinese investments in U.S. real estate, a topic of growing concern amid fears of foreign influence over critical sectors.

Family Connections and Political Implications

The connection between Malkin and Senator Blumenthal has ignited allegations of a possible conflict of interest. Critics argue that Malkin’s extensive dealings with Chinese entities could compromise the Senator’s integrity, given his significant stance on issues of national security and foreign influence. Blumenthal’s wife, Cynthia, is a shareholder in Malkin’s company, further complicating the issue by intertwining political interests with financial ones.

Senator Blumenthal’s office has publicly stated that he is not involved in Malkin’s business decisions and that his wife, like many other shareholders of a public company, has no control over its operations. The spokesperson emphasized the Senator’s commitment to transparency and ethical governance, noting his support for measures to ban Congress members from holding stocks that could create conflicts of interest. Nonetheless, the optics of Malkin’s connections persist, and some constituents express concerns regarding potential undue influence from foreign powers.

Responses from Malkin and Political Associates

In response to inquiries about his connections with the Chinese government and its diplomats, Malkin has expressed that his focus has always been on business opportunities rather than political affiliations. A spokesperson for Empire State Realty Trust stated that Malkin has not directly engaged with many of the claims made regarding his business dealings. They characterized Malkin’s connections as partnerships formed out of industry needs rather than political alliances. Furthermore, the spokesperson claimed that Malkin was unaware of specifics mentioned in the 2011 media profile article, which suggested a greater degree of cooperation with the CCP.

Malkin’s interactions have also included discussions about tourism and cultural exchanges as a means of bolstering business relationships with Chinese companies. Nevertheless, as suspicions regarding foreign influence increase, Malkin’s explanations may not quell public concerns about his role and that of his family’s political ties in shaping these dynamics.
